Understanding Phase Issues
Phase issues occur when two or more audio signals interact with each other in ways that can cause certain frequencies to cancel out or reinforce each other. This can lead to a muddy mix or a lack of clarity. It’s crucial to identify these problems early in your mixing workflow.
Common Causes of Phase Issues
- Microphone placement during recording.
- Using multiple microphones on the same source.
- Time alignment discrepancies between tracks.
- Effects processing that alters timing.
Identifying Phase Problems
To effectively troubleshoot phase issues, you need to first identify them. Here are some signs that you may be experiencing phase problems:
- Inconsistent frequency response in the mix.
- Loss of low-end power or clarity.
- Increased muddiness in the overall sound.
- Inability to hear specific elements clearly.
Techniques for Troubleshooting Phase Issues
1. Check Microphone Placement
When recording, the placement of microphones can greatly affect phase relationships. Ensure that microphones are positioned correctly to avoid phase cancellation.
2. Use Phase Alignment Tools
Many digital audio workstations (DAWs) offer phase alignment tools that can help you adjust the timing of tracks. Use these tools to align tracks that may be out of phase.
3. Experiment with Panning
Panning can help mitigate phase issues by distributing sounds across the stereo field. Experiment with different panning positions to see if it improves the clarity of your mix.
4. Adjust Timing Manually
If you suspect that timing discrepancies are causing phase issues, try nudging tracks slightly forward or backward in the timeline to find a better phase relationship.
Using EQ to Address Phase Issues
Equalization (EQ) can also be a powerful tool in addressing phase problems. By cutting certain frequencies, you can reduce the impact of phase cancellation.
1. Identify Problematic Frequencies
Use a spectrum analyzer to identify frequencies that are causing issues. Once identified, you can use EQ to reduce or eliminate them.
2. Apply Subtractive EQ
Subtractive EQ involves cutting frequencies rather than boosting them. This can help in minimizing the impact of phase issues without introducing additional problems.
Final Checks and Balancing
After implementing troubleshooting techniques, it’s important to conduct final checks on your mix. Listen critically to ensure that all elements are clear and well-balanced.
1. Use Reference Tracks
Comparing your mix to professional reference tracks can provide insights into how your mix holds up against industry standards. This can help you identify any lingering phase issues.
2. Test on Multiple Systems
Listening to your mix on various playback systems (headphones, studio monitors, car speakers) can help reveal phase issues that may not be apparent on your primary monitoring setup.
